本站简介作品介绍购买指南发布作品订做说明专业诚信
本站收录了大量的毕业设计和论文 [vison]       本站提供这些设计的初衷 [vison]      
管理系统 学生 计算机 教学 信息 电路 汽车 模具 网站 建筑
您现在的位置:首页 >> 信息资讯文献综述

计算机毕业论文文献综述(网上书店系统)

编辑:admin 来源:papersay.com   客服QQ:281788421 (为了更好的为您服务,请先加好友再咨询)

文献综述
前言
Internet的广泛应用极大地推动了人类社会的进步,尤其是进入二十世纪九十年代以来,以电子商务为代表的应用更是如潮水般迅速渗透到了社会经济领域的各个角落,给全球经济带来一次新的革命,有力地推动了商业、贸易、营销、金融、广告运输、教育等各领域的创新,也逐渐改变了整个商业社会的竞争格局。因此有人曾预言:网络不仅是二十一整个世界经济增长的发动机,而且在今后的五到十年之间,任何一个行业如果不实施电子商务,就会由于无商可务而走向死亡。
    传统书店也不例外,尤其是随着我国2001年底正式加入WTO,国内的传统书店将面临着更多的机遇与挑战:一方面随着贸易壁垒的降低,今后图书市场的分销必将处于开放领域,国外的图书业一定会凭借着电子商务的技术优势对我国的传统书店形成威胁,另一方面,网上书店也破除了很多由来已久的自然垄断和信息资源的不均衡颁布。赋予人们更加平等的竞争地位。因此,构建网上书店不失为促进对外版权贸易,提高我国图书在国际市场的竞争力,活跃经济,甚至成为引领我们赶上发达国家的“火箭加速器”。
主题
随着计算机网络的发展,特别是Internet使我们步入了一个前所未有的信息时代,网上冲浪已成为我们日常生活中不可缺少的一部分。而实际上现在的Internet可以说只是一个开端,还蕴藏着很大的潜力,这一切都给Java提供了用武之地。Java已经不是一个语言的概念,而是一种技术,我们生活中的许多方面都涉及这种技术,而且涉及面会越来越广。所以,无论是在学校拥有计算机基础知识的学生,还是刚进入IT领域的起步者或者已是在IT业界具有一些实际经验的人士,都有熟悉和掌握该Java 更深入的知识的需求。其中JSP技术是目前应用开发中的核心技术,也是目前流行的3P技术中应用最为广泛的一种。3P技术分别是:ASP(Active Server Pages)、PHP(Personal HomePage)和JSP(Java Server Pages)。JSP最初是SUN公司推出的,ASP是Microsoft公司的产品,PHP是一个网络小组开发和维护的。目前最常用的是JSP和ASP(ASP.NET)。首先要学会建立并且理解Web Server。因为Apache是免费的,并且能在大多数平台上工作,推荐使用Apache的Tomcat;理解HTML/XHTML,特别是HTML布局中的TABLE标记;学习Java的逻辑,学习JavaBean、JavaScript,学习利用它在HTML中验证输入的Form元素以及动态地修改Form元素等知识[3]。瞄准目前J2EE最热门的几个应用领域,精选出几个大小度的应用案例。这些经典实例,紧紧围绕J2EE的各种核心技术,进行自底向上,由内向外的层层分析和分部解构。既保证有一定的实用性,同时也要确保一定的广度和深度,主要覆盖了J2EE中比较基础但又非常流行的技术,如JavaBean、Serverlet、JSP、JDBC等技术,还涉及SQL等数据库系统、Tomcat应用服务器,以及Internet 的相关技术[9]。
采用JSP技术,Web页面开发人员可以使用HTML或者XML标记来设计和格式化最终页面,使用JSP代码或者小脚本程序来生成页面上的动态内容。在服务器,JSP引擎解释JSP代码和小脚本程序,生成所请求的内容,并且将结果以HTML或者XML页面的形式发送回浏览器。JSP技术很容易整合到多种应用体系结构中,以利用现存的工具和技巧,并且扩展到能够支持企业级的分布式应用[1]。由于JSP页面的内置脚本语言是基于Java编程语言的,拥有Java编程语言“一次编写,各处运行”的特点,而且所有的JSP页面都被编译成为Java ServletClass,JSP页面就具有Java技术的所有好处,包括稳定的存储管理和安全性。 更多的毕业设计论文文献综述请到 www.papersay.com
在查阅了关于Java技术中的JSP等技术的文献后,利用软件工程的思想,通过了解与用户沟通获取需求的方法,形式化说明技术,逐步求精,人机界面设计,回归测试,控制结构测试,预防性维护与软件再工程,面向对象测试策略及设计测试用例的方法,能力成熟模型等知识设计整个网上书店系统[7]。互联网成为与报纸、广播、电视相比肩的第四媒体,同时正以其便捷的信息传输方式改变着人们的消费模式,利用简单、快捷、低成本的电子通信方式,买卖双方不谋面就可以进行着各种交易活动,走向商业的互联网已经成为网络经济的大势所趋。1996年前后,在美国学术界提出“电子商务”(E-Business或E-Commerce)的概念短短几年的时间里,这一概念已经全球各地被广泛接受。根据买卖双文的不同,电子商务市场可以划分为4种类型:B2B,B2C,C2B,C2C。就规模而言,B2B和B2C居于主导地位。B2C是商家与顾客之间的商务活动,它将成为电子商务的一种主要的商务形式。眼下电子商务网站正如雨后春笋般地大量涌现,企业网络化已经成为一种时尚[4]。
本次所要设计的系统是一个基于Web的书店系统。我们可以将使用该系统的人划分为两个角色:一个是普通用户,主要是通过系统在线选择要购买的书籍并提交订单;另一个是管理员,主要是通过系统对用户、订单及图书进行管理[5]。在设计开发中,应采用基于Browser/Server的三层数据库应用体系结构,三层结构自成体系,任何一层的变化,不需要其他另外两层的变化,适宜于任何底层操作系统。可将图书、订单等实体封装成相应的类和与其对应的操作类,提高了对数据库操作的安全性和系统的可扩展性[2]。最终以实现会员注册,图书查询,用户购物车,用户下单,在线帮助,后台图书管理,广告管理,会员管理,订单管理,管理员管理,网站基本信息等功能,充分利用计算机网络技术,改进现有的购物方式,做到适合现代人生活的购物方式。

参考文献
[1] 王国栋,杨树勋等著.JSP在网上书店中的应用.青岛:青岛科技大学学报.第24卷第3期
[2] 马新.基于网上书店系统的设计与实现
[3] 朱福喜,傅建明等著.Java项目设计与开发范例.北京:电子工业出版社,2005
[4] 汪孝宜,徐佳晶等著.JSP数据库开发实例精粹.北京:电子工业出版社,2005
[5] 张军著.JSP网络应用开发例学与实践.北京:清华大学出版社,2006
[6] 布雷恩•赖特著.JSP数据库编程指南.北京:北京希望电子出版社,2001
[7] 萨师煊,王珊著.数据库系统概论.北京:高等教育出版社,2000
[8] 张海藩著.软件工程导论.北京:清华大学出版社,2003
[9] 石志国,董洁等著.JSP应用教程.北京:清华大学出版社,2004
[10] 王国辉,李立文等著.JSP数据库系统开发完全手册.2006